Crime overview

Faraday Road area has the 37th highest crime rate of 84 local areas in Baylis & Salt Hill , and the 136th highest crime rate of 388 local areas in Slough .

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.

The overall crime rate in the area around Faraday Road (SL2 1RU) in the last 12 months was 104.4 per 1,000 residents and was 24.4% lower than the Baylis & Salt Hill average (138.1 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 20 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Other theft 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-25.0%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 22 (≈ 60.4 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-4.3%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-51.0%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Faraday Road (SL2 1RU), the main crime hotspot is near Petrol Station. Police recorded 156 crimes here, including 61 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
